CrossFit blends strength, gymnastics, and conditioning into varied functional workouts. This beginner foundations program teaches the core movements — squat, press, hinge — with lighter loads, then finishes each session with a short, scalable WOD. Learn the patterns properly now and intensity can safely follow.

Workout Of the Day — the conditioning piece that follows the strength work. Here each WOD is a short, scalable circuit.
Prioritise technique over load and speed while you learn the movements. Scale pull-ups (bands/ring rows) and box height to your ability. Rest fully during the strength portion; keep conditioning moderate. Stop if form breaks or you feel sharp pain.
